The New York Giants had been rumored to be wanting to move on from Odell Beckham Jr. this offseason, and they pulled the trigger on a monster deal on Tuesday night. The deal sends OBJ to the Cleveland Browns from the Browns No. 17 overall pick in 2019, the Browns second third round pick this April, and safety Jabrill Peppers.
During his time in New York, Beckham established himself as one of the premier wide receivers in football, and now he joins a Cleveland team that is definitely pointing in the right direction. The Giants will now have to replace incredible production, and with the Browns No. 17 overall pick, they could bring in Oklahoma’s Marquise Brown.
Brown is a guy who proved to be the elite wide receiver in college football during his time with the Sooners, catching balls from two Heisman Trophy winning quarterbacks. In this mock, Brown heads to the Big Apple, where he will join an offense that features on of the best running backs in football in Saquon Barkley, who dominated in year one in 2018.
Peppers will also fill an immediate need for the Giants, who let Landon Collins walk in free agency this offseason. The Giants have been making head-scratching moves so far this offseason, and while Beckham’s trade came as a shock, it had been appearing for a while that his time in New York was coming to an end.
